Inp.polri.go.id - Jakarta. A mild, shallow magnitude 3.5 earthquake rattled Sarmi Regency, Papua, on Friday morning (10/7/2026). The Meteorology, Climatology, and Geophysics Agency (BMKG) announced that the localized tremor occurred at approximately 10.50 am, with its epicenter situated inland to the southwest of the coastal region.
According to the official real-time data bulletin released via BMKG's social media broadcasting channels, the earthquake's coordinates were determined to be at 2.58 South Latitude and 138.76 East Longitude. Automated tracking systems placed the center of the seismic activity roughly 50 kilometers southwest of Sarmi at a shallow depth of 13 kilometers.
"This information prioritizes speed, meaning the results of data processing are not yet fully stable and may change as additional data becomes available," BMKG said in its standard real-time technical disclaimer.
There were no immediate reports from local authorities regarding structural damage or physical injuries resulting from the tremor.
